The story

Falles d'Andorra in Andorra la Vella/Sant Julia de Loria/Escaldes/other parishes

The Falles d'Andorra are UNESCO-listed fire rituals in which birch-bark torches are carried down from the mountains into town squares and burned around a bonfire, held on 23 June across Andorra la Vella, Sant Julià de Lòria, Escaldes-Engordany and Encamp, and on 28 June in Ordino, as part of the Pyrenees' shared summer solstice fire tradition.

Birch-bark torches carried and spun down from the mountains into town squares, then gathered into a single bonfire around a fire tree, are the core image behind the Falles d'Andorra, and it is a tradition with formal international recognition rather than a purely local custom.

What is special

The part that makes it specific.

01

The place changes

Formal UNESCO recognition, granted in December 2015 as part of a 63-town multinational nomination across Andorra, Spain and France, sets this apart from a purely local bonfire night, and the specific split across two dates and two saints' eves, four parishes on Sant Joan's eve, Ordino alone on Sant Pere's eve, gives the tradition a structured, documented pattern rather than a single generic midsummer fire

02

The mystery stays covered

The construction method itself, boxwood wrapped in birch bark, is a named, specific craft rather than an improvised torch
